等离子体发射光谱法分析毒砂单矿物

Analysis of Arsenopyrite by Inductively Coupled Plasma-Atomic Emission Spectrum

  • 摘要: 研究了大孔膦酸树脂对毒砂中主、次和痕量元素的吸附行为及洗脱条件,结合巯基棉和TBP柱分离技术,建立了两个分离流程。在J-A1160型多道直读光谱仪上实现了毒砂单矿物中包括主量元素Fe和As在内的20个元素测定。主量元素As和Fe的相对标准偏差(n为5~10)分别为1.03%和0.9%,其它元素在5%~11%范围。流程经实际试样分析验证,结果与化学法相符。
